diff --git a/apps-archived/maerchenzauber/apps/web/src/routes/(protected)/settings/+page.svelte b/apps-archived/maerchenzauber/apps/web/src/routes/(protected)/settings/+page.svelte
index 4ac83a1af..d95fb9405 100644
--- a/apps-archived/maerchenzauber/apps/web/src/routes/(protected)/settings/+page.svelte
+++ b/apps-archived/maerchenzauber/apps/web/src/routes/(protected)/settings/+page.svelte
@@ -4,6 +4,15 @@
import { goto } from '$app/navigation';
import { dataService } from '$lib/api';
import { toastStore } from '$lib/stores/toast.svelte';
+ import {
+ SettingsPage,
+ SettingsSection,
+ SettingsCard,
+ SettingsRow,
+ SettingsToggle,
+ SettingsDangerZone,
+ SettingsDangerButton,
+ } from '@manacore/shared-ui';
// Stats
let storyCount = $state(0);
@@ -76,22 +85,19 @@
toastStore.success('Bildmodell gespeichert');
}
}
+
+ async function handleLogout() {
+ await authStore.signOut();
+ goto('/login');
+ }
- Verwalte dein Konto und deine Einstellungen -
-Dunkelmodus
-- {isDarkMode ? 'Aktiviert' : 'Deaktiviert'} -
-
+
+
Wähle das KI-Modell für die Illustration deiner Geschichten
{model.name} {model.description} {model.name} {model.description}
{authStore.user?.email || '-'}
-Benutzer-ID
-- {authStore.user?.id || '-'} -
-Mana verwalten
-Abonnement und Guthaben
+Mana verwalten
+Abonnement und Guthaben
Feedback & Ideen
-Stimme für Features ab
-Archiv
-- Archivierte Geschichten und Charaktere -
-Hilfe
-FAQ und Support
-- Choose how Memoro looks. System automatically matches your device's theme. -
-- If you delete your account, all your data will be permanently deleted. This action - cannot be undone. -
++ Choose how Memoro looks. System automatically matches your device's theme. +
+{currentUser.email || 'No email available'}
-Made with ❤️ in Germany
- {#if clickCount > 0 && clickCount < 7} -{7 - clickCount} more clicks...
- {/if} -Made with love in Germany
+ {#if clickCount > 0 && clickCount < 7} ++ {7 - clickCount} more clicks... +
+ {/if}Verwalte dein Konto und App-Einstellungen
-{$user?.email || 'Nicht angemeldet'}
-Benutzer-ID
-{$user?.id || '—'}
-Dunkles Design
-- Aktiviere den Dark Mode für eine augenfreundliche Ansicht -
-Daten exportieren
-- Exportiere alle deine Mahlzeiten und Statistiken -
-Alle Daten löschen
-- Löscht alle deine Mahlzeiten und Statistiken unwiderruflich -
-Alle Daten löschen
++ Löscht alle deine Mahlzeiten und Statistiken unwiderruflich +
+Nutriphi Web v0.1.0
-Teil des Mana Core Ökosystems
-+ Teil des Mana Core Ökosystems +
+Manage your account and preferences
-- Manage your account settings and preferences -
-{auth.user?.email}
-User ID
-{auth.user?.id}
-Choose your preferred theme
+ +Theme
++ Choose your preferred theme +
Sign out
-- Sign out of your account on this device -
-+ Wird als Standard-Autor für eigene Zitate verwendet +
Wird als Standard-Autor für eigene Zitate verwendet
-Dunkles Farbschema verwenden
-
- {#if THEME_DEFINITIONS[theme.variant].icon && themeIcons[THEME_DEFINITIONS[theme.variant].icon as keyof typeof themeIcons]}
-
So sieht die App mit dem aktuellen Theme aus
-Farbvorschau
++ So sieht die App mit dem aktuellen Theme aus +
+Sprache der App und Zitate
-Sprache
+Sprache der App und Zitate
+{description}
+ {/if} +{subtitle}
+ {/if} +